Perfect Puddings to Serve with Roast Beef
Roast beef is a classic Sunday roast, and a great way to bring the family together. It’s important to make sure that the sides and desserts are just as delicious! To make your meal even more memorable, why not serve a classic pudding with your roast beef? Here are some perfect puddings to serve with roast beef:
Apple Crumble is always a favourite. It’s simple to make, and can be served hot or cold. Simply layer sliced apples in an oven-proof dish, top with a crumble mixture of oats, sugar and butter and bake in the oven until golden brown. Serve with cream or ice cream for the perfect accompaniment to your roast beef.
Another pudding that is sure to please is sticky toffee pudding. This indulgent dessert is made by combining dates, butter and sugar in a cake tin before pouring a hot sticky toffee sauce over the top. Bake in the oven until golden brown before serving with cream or ice cream for an extra special treat.
If you’re looking for something a bit lighter, then try making a trifle. Layering fruit and custard in layers creates an impressive dessert that everyone will love. Top with whipped cream and grated chocolate for an added touch of indulgence!
Finally, why not try making a classic lemon meringue pie? The tartness of the lemon combined with sweet meringue can make even the most jaded palate happy! Simply whisk egg whites until stiff peaks form before spooning over the top of your cooled lemon filling – bake in the oven until golden brown before serving as an impressive finish to your meal!

Sweet Additions to Accompany Roast Beef Meals
Roast beef is a classic dish that can be enjoyed in many different ways. To add a sweet touch to this timeless meal, there are several delicious accompaniments that can be served alongside. Roast beef pairs well with all sorts of fruits, sauces, and desserts. From jams and jellies to baked apples and honey glazes, there are plenty of sweet options to complement a roast beef meal.
Fruits like apples, pears or grapes make an excellent accompaniment for roast beef. They can be served raw or cooked into sauces or chutneys for extra flavor. Apples can be used to make a simple yet tasty apple cider gravy or even a tart apple chutney. Pears can be roasted and topped with honey for an elegant touch, while grapes make great toppings for salads or sandwiches.
Jams and jellies are also classic accompaniments for roast beef meals. A variety of flavors can be used to create unique sauces or glazes that make the roast beef even more flavorful. Jams like raspberry or strawberry pair especially well with the savory flavors of the meat while jellies like grapefruit or apricot provide a nice contrast in texture and sweetness. Another great way to add sweetness is with honey glazes; they lend the perfect hint of sweetness without overwhelming the other flavors in the dish.
Baked apples are another classic way to add sweetness to a roast beef meal. Apples can be cored out, filled with butter and spices, then baked until they become tender and juicy—the perfect addition to any meal! They also go well with roasted potatoes and vegetables for an all-in-one side dish that provides both sweet and savory flavors in one bite.
